د JPEG کمپریشن الګوریتم څه شی دی؟

وروستی تازه: 21/09/2023

د JPEG کمپریشن الګوریتم څه شی دی؟

JPEG (د عکسونو د متخصصینو ګډ ګروپ) کمپریشن الګوریتم یو معیار دی چې په پراخه کچه د ډیجیټل عکسونو کمپریشن کې کارول کیږي ، په ځانګړي توګه په عکس اخیستو او انټرنیټ کې د عکسونو لیږد کې. دا الګوریتم تاسو ته اجازه درکوي د عکس فایلونو اندازه کمه کړئ پرته لدې چې د پام وړ لید کیفیت له لاسه ورکړئ. دا په مختلفو غوښتنلیکونو کې د هغې د اغیزمنتیا او شهرت لپاره پیژندل کیږي.

1. د JPEG کمپریشن الګوریتم پیژندنه

د JPEG کمپریشن الګوریتم یو تخنیک دی چې د عکس فایلونو اندازې کمولو لپاره کارول کیږي، پرته له دې چې د دوی لید کیفیت د پام وړ اغیزه وکړي. دا په 1992 کې د ګډ عکس العمل متخصص ګروپ (JPEG) لخوا رامینځته شوی او له هغه وروسته یو له خورا مشهور شوی. د ډیجیټل عکسونو د کمپریس کولو میتودونه.

د JPEG کمپریشن "ضررناک" کمپریشن ګڼل کیږي، د دې معنی دا ده د کمپریشن پروسې په جریان کې د معلوماتو له لاسه ورکول شتون لري. په هرصورت، دا زیان په ډیری قضیو کې د انسان سترګو ته د منلو وړ نه دی، ځکه چې بې ځایه معلومات چې د سترګو سترګو ته د پام وړ ندي له منځه وړل کیږي. دا د JPEG کمپریشن په وسیلو لکه ډیجیټل کیمرې ، ګرځنده تلیفونونو کې د عکس ښودنې لپاره مثالی کوي ګورت ځایونه.

د JPEG کمپریشن الګوریتم د کمپریشن تخنیکونو ترکیب کاروي لکه د جلا کوزین ټرانسفارم (DCT) او مقدار کول. DCT عکس د 8x8 پکسلز په بلاکونو ویشي او هر بلاک د کوفیفینس په لړۍ بدلوي چې د عکس فریکونسۍ استازیتوب کوي. بیا مقدار کول پلي کیږي ، چیرې چې د دې ضمیمو دقیقیت کم شوی ترڅو د عکس نمایش لپاره اړین ډیټا کم کړي. دا پروسه بدلون او مقدار کول په تکراري ډول ترسره کیږي تر هغه چې مطلوب کمپریشن ترلاسه نشي.

2. د JPEG کمپریشن الګوریتم بنسټیز اصول

د JPEG کمپریشن الګوریتم په پراخه کچه کارول شوی تخنیک دی چې د عکس فایلونو اندازه کموي پرته لدې چې ډیر لید کیفیت له لاسه ورکړي. دا الګوریتم د بې ځایه کیدو له مینځه وړلو او د عکس ډیټا غوره کمپریشن پراساس دی. د JPEG الګوریتم اصلي ګټه د فایل اندازې کې د پام وړ کمښت سره د عکسونو کمپرس کولو وړتیا ده ، د ډیجیټل عکسونو اسانه ذخیره کولو او لیږد ته اجازه ورکوي.

د JPEG کمپریشن پروسه په دوه اصلي مرحلو ولاړه ده: له ځایي ډومین څخه د فریکونسۍ ډومین ته بدلون د جلا کوزین ټرانسفارم (DCT) په کارولو سره ، او د DCT کوفیفینټس مقدار کول. دا بدلون د عکس ډیټا ته اجازه ورکوي چې د هغې د فریکونسۍ مینځپانګې په شرایطو کې نمایش شي ، کوم چې د لوړې فریکونسۍ اجزاو کمپریشن او د هغه توضیحاتو له مینځه وړو لپاره اسانه کوي چې د انسان سترګو ته د لید وړ ندي.

ځانګړې محتوا - دلته کلیک وکړئ  په Excel کې د حجرو پټولو څرنګوالی

د JPEG کمپریشن الګوریتم بل کلیدي اړخ د Huffman کوډ کولو کارول دي ترڅو د عکس ډیټا ډیر اغیزمن استازیتوب وکړي. د هفمن کوډ کول د لوړې پیښې فریکونسیو ته لنډ کوډونه او د ټیټ پیښې فریکونسیو ته اوږد کوډونه ورکوي، د کوډ اندازه نوره هم کموي. فشار شوی دوتنه د کیفیت له لاسه ورکولو پرته. برسېره پردې، د JPEG الګوریتم هم د مختلف کمپریشن کچې مالتړ کوي، تاسو ته اجازه درکوي د ځانګړو اړتیاو سره سم د عکس کیفیت تنظیم کړئ.

3. د JPEG الګوریتم کمپریشن پروسه

El JPEG کمپریشن الګوریتم د عکس فایلونو اندازه کمولو لپاره په پراخه کچه کارول شوي تخنیک دی پرته لدې چې د دوی لید کیفیت د پام وړ اغیزه وکړي. دا پروسه د تاواني کمپریشن د اصولو پر بنسټ والړ ده، کوم چې دا معنی لري ځینې ​​توضیحات د عکس څخه لیرې شوي چې د انسان سترګو ته د لیدو وړ نه دي. الګوریتم د عکس د پکسلونو په بلاکونو ویشلو او بیا د معلوماتو د بې ځایه کیدو کمولو لپاره د ریاضيکي بدلونونو لړۍ پلي کولو سره کار کوي.

یو له مهمو ګامونو څخه دی د فریکونسۍ ډومین بدلون. په دې مرحله کې، انځور د ځایی ډومین څخه د فریکونسۍ ډومین ته بدلیږي جلا کوزین بدلون (DCT). DCT انځور د مختلفو فریکونسۍ اجزاو په لړۍ کې ماتوي، د ټیټ فریکونسۍ سره د عکس خورا مهم توضیحات استازیتوب کوي او لوړې فریکونسۍ د غوره توضیحاتو استازیتوب کوي.

د JPEG کمپریشن پروسې بل اړین ګام دی اندازه کول. په دې مرحله کې، د DCT څخه ترلاسه شوي د فریکوینسي کوفیشینټونه د مخکیني تعریف شوي مقدار کولو ارزښتونو لړۍ لخوا ویشل شوي. دا په پایله کې a دقت له لاسه ورکول په فریکونسی کوفیینټ کې، د فایل اندازې نور کمولو ته اجازه ورکوي. مقدار کول په داسې ډول ترسره کیږي چې معرفي شوي غلطۍ د انسان سترګو ته د منلو وړ ندي، په دې توګه د فشار شوي عکس د منلو وړ لید کیفیت تضمینوي.

4. د JPEG الګوریتم په کارولو سره د عکس کیفیت تحلیل

د JPEG کمپریشن الګوریتم یو له ډیرو څخه دی چې د فایلونو اندازه کمولو لپاره کارول کیږي. د انځور فایلونه پرته له دې چې ډیر کیفیت له لاسه ورکړي. دا الګوریتم د زیانمن کمپریشن تخنیک کاروي، دا پدې مانا ده چې ځینې توضیحات د عکس څخه لرې شوي ترڅو د هغې اندازه کمه کړي. په هرصورت ، د توضیحاتو مقدار چې له مینځه وړل کیږي کنټرول کیږي او هدف یې د عکس لید کیفیت ساتل دي.

د عکس کیفیت د JPEG الګوریتم په کارولو سره د ازموینې له لارې تحلیل کیږي د کمپریس شوي فایل اندازې او د پام وړ عکس کیفیت ترمنځ اړیکه. د دې کولو لپاره، JPEG د PSNR په نوم یو میټریک کاروي (د لوړ سیګنال څخه شور تناسب) چې د اصلي عکس او کمپریس شوي عکس ترمنځ توپیر اندازه کوي. د PSNR لوړ ارزښت د غوره عکس کیفیت په ګوته کوي ، ځکه چې دا پدې معنی ده چې د دواړو ترمینځ توپیرونه کوچني دي.

ځانګړې محتوا - دلته کلیک وکړئ  د تېروتنې کوډ 411 څه معنی لري او څنګه یې حل کړئ؟

بل مهم فکتور دی د کمپریشن تناسب. دا تناسب د اصلي فایل اندازه د کمپریس شوي فایل اندازې په ویشلو سره محاسبه کیږي. څومره چې دا تناسب لوړ وي، د کمپریشن لوی او د فایل اندازه کوچنۍ وي، مګر د کیفیت ضایع هم لوی وي. له همدې امله، دا مهمه ده چې د فایل اندازه او د مطلوب عکس کیفیت ترمنځ توازن ومومئ.

5. د JPEG کمپریشن الګوریتم ګټې او زیانونه

د JPEG کمپریشن الګوریتم یو پراخه کارول شوی تخنیک دی چې د کیفیت له پامه غورځولو پرته د عکسونو فایل اندازه کموي. دا د غیر ضروري توضیحاتو لرې کولو او د ډیسکیټ کوسین ټرانسفارم (DCT) پروسس پراساس د کمپریشن تخنیک کارولو سره ترلاسه کیږي.

د JPEG کمپریشن الګوریتم یوه له اصلي ګټو څخه د دې وړتیا ده چې د اصلي غیر کمپریس شوي فایل په پرتله تر 95٪ پورې د فایل اندازه کمه کړي. دا په ځانګړي توګه په داسې شرایطو کې ګټور دی چیرې چې د د ډیسک ځای محدود دی یا چیرته چې د عکس بارولو سرعت مهم دی، لکه د ویب په شرایطو کې. برسیره پردې، د JPEG کمپریشن د عکسونو تدریجي ښودلو ته اجازه ورکوي، پدې معنی چې انځورونه په ټیټ ریزولوشن کې په چټکۍ سره پورته کیدی شي او بیا په تدریجي ډول بشپړ کیفیت ته وده ورکول کیږي.

په هرصورت، هم شتون لري زیانونه د JPEG کمپریشن الګوریتم سره تړاو لري. یو له اصلي نیمګړتیاو څخه دا دی چې د JPEG کمپریشن یو زیانمن الګوریتم دی ، پدې معنی د انځور کیفیت اغیزمن شوی لکه څنګه چې د فایل اندازه کمه شوې. دا کولی شي د ښه توضیحاتو او کمپریشن هنرونو لکه د عکس بندولو په څیر د ګړندیتوب کمولو پایله ولري. سربیره پردې ، د JPEG کمپریشن د عکسونو لپاره مناسب ندي چیرې چې دا د ټولو توضیحاتو او رنګونو ساتل مهم دي ، لکه څنګه چې د طبي حالت کې. انځورونه یا مسلکي عکسونه.

په لنډیز کې، د JPEG کمپریشن الګوریتم یو ګټور وسیله ده چې تاسو ته اجازه درکوي د کیفیت د پام وړ زیان پرته د عکس فایلونو اندازه د پام وړ کمه کړئ. په هرصورت، دا مهمه ده چې د دې الګوریتم محدودیتونه په پام کې ونیسئ او ارزونه وکړئ چې آیا غوره دی د هرې ځانګړې قضیې لپاره اختیار. که هدف د لوړ ممکنه عکس کیفیت ساتل وي، په پای کې د کمپریشن نور تخنیکونه باید په پام کې ونیول شي، د مناسب کمپریشن الګوریتم غوره کول به د هرې پروژې په ځانګړو اړتیاوو پورې اړه ولري.

ځانګړې محتوا - دلته کلیک وکړئ  په وینډوز 10 کې د مایکروفون ازموینې څرنګوالی

6. د JPEG کمپریشن د غوره کولو لپاره سپارښتنې

JPEG کمپریشن په پراخه کچه کارول شوی الګوریتم دی ترڅو د عکسونو اندازه کمه کړي پرته لدې چې د دوی لید کیفیت د پام وړ موافقت وکړي. د JPEG کمپریشن اصلاح کولو لپاره، دا مهمه ده چې ځینې سپارښتنې تعقیب کړئ چې د پایلو ترلاسه کولو کې به مرسته وکړي لوړ کیفیت او د فایل اندازه کوچنۍ ده.

1. د کمپریشن کچه تنظیم کړئ: د JPEG الګوریتم تاسو ته اجازه درکوي د کمپریشن کچه تنظیم کړئ ترڅو د بصری کیفیت او فایل اندازه توازن کړئ. دا مهمه ده چې غوره کچه ومومئ چې تاسو ته اجازه درکوي د فایل اندازه کمه کړئ پرته لدې چې د عکس کیفیت کې د ډیر تخریب لامل شي. ډیری وختونه، د 50٪ او 80٪ ترمنځ د کمپریشن کچه یو ښه توازن وړاندې کوي.

2. د پرله پسې فشارونو څخه ډډه وکړئ: په ورته عکس کې د څو پرله پسې فشارونو ترسره کول کولی شي د کیفیت مجموعي زیان لامل شي. دا مشوره ورکول کیږي چې تل د اصلي غیر کمپریس شوي فایل یوه کاپي وساتئ او په کاپيونو کار وکړئ ترڅو د تخریب مخه ونیول شي.

3. بې ځایه معلومات لرې کړئ: مخکې لدې چې عکس کمپریس کړئ ، دا مشوره ورکول کیږي چې د بې ځایه معلوماتو لرې کولو لپاره تنظیمات وکړئ. پدې کې د عکس مناسب کښت کول، د غیر ضروري عناصرو لرې کول، او د امکان په صورت کې د رنګ ژوروالی کمول شامل دي. دا ګامونه به د فایل اندازه کمولو او د کمپریشن موثریت ښه کولو کې مرسته وکړي.

7. د JPEG کمپریشن الګوریتم غوښتنلیکونه او کارول

El JPEG کمپریشن الګوریتم دا یو معیار دی چې په پراخه کچه د عکاسي او ډیجیټل امیجنگ صنعت کې کارول کیږي. دا د پام وړ اندازه کمولو توان لري د فایل څخه پرته له دې چې د بصری کیفیت باندې ډیر جوړجاړی وکړي. دا په انتخابي ډول د بې ځایه معلوماتو او توضیحاتو لرې کولو سره ترلاسه کیږي چې د انسان سترګو ته د منلو وړ ندي.

یو له اصلي د JPEG کمپریشن الګوریتم غوښتنلیکونه دا د انټرنیټ له لارې د عکسونو لیږد کې دی. لوی، غیر کمپریس شوي عکسونه کولی شي پورته کولو لپاره ډیر وخت ونیسي، په پایله کې د کاروونکي ضعیف تجربه. د JPEG الګوریتم په کارولو سره ، دا ممکنه ده چې د عکسونو اندازه کمه کړئ ، د ګړندي او ډیر موثر لیږد لپاره اجازه ورکوي.

نور د JPEG کمپریشن الګوریتم عام استعمال د محدود ظرفیت سره په وسیلو کې د عکسونو ذخیره کولو کې دی ، لکه ډیجیټل کیمرې یا ګرځنده تلیفونونه. دا وسیلې معمولا د ذخیره کولو محدود مقدار لري ، نو د ډیر کیفیت له لاسه ورکولو پرته د عکسونو کمپریس کولو وړتیا اړینه ده. د JPEG الګوریتم کاروونکو ته اجازه ورکوي چې په خپلو وسایلو کې ډیر عکسونه ذخیره کړي پرته لدې چې ډیر ځای ونیسي.